The purpose of quot;Content-availablequot; in Push Notification Json?(推送通知Json中的Quot;Content-AvailableQuot;的目的是什么?)
问题描述
其目的是发送仅带有徽章值的推送通知&;没有其他内容(无横幅)。
我集成了Parse SDK测试推送通知&;发送此推送通知
{
"alert" :"",
"badge" :"787",
"Content-available" : "1",
"sound" : ""
}
因此,推送通知在应用程序处于后台时发送,在应用程序被终止时发送前台&;。 实现了利用徽章阀78在推送通知到达时擦除一些数据的目的。 我发送了与"Content-Available"相同的通知:"1"已删除,但一切工作正常。
我对"Content-Available"的理解是,将其值设置为1将允许没有警报值的推送通知。
因此,我感到困惑或遗漏了一些东西,无法了解此推送通知json中"内容可用"的含义。
谢谢
推荐答案
如果您为该注册表项提供值1,(如果用户打开您的应用程序处于后台或已恢复),则将调用application:didReceiveRemoteNotification:fetchCompletionHandler:。
根据RemoteNotifications Programmingcontent-available
定义为
为该键提供值1,以指示新内容 有空的。包括此键和值意味着当您的应用程序 在后台启动或恢复, application:didReceiveRemoteNotification:fetchCompletionHandler:是 已调用。(保证报摊应用程序至少能接收一次推送 每24小时窗口使用该密钥。)
这篇关于推送通知Json中的&Quot;Content-Available&Quot;的目的是什么?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持编程学习网!
本文标题为:推送通知Json中的&Quot;Content-Available&Quot;的目的是什么?


- 用 Swift 实现 UITextFieldDelegate 2022-01-01
- 如何检查发送到 Android 应用程序的 Firebase 消息的传递状态? 2022-01-01
- MalformedJsonException:在第1行第1列路径中使用JsonReader.setLenient(True)接受格式错误的JSON 2022-01-01
- android 4中的android RadioButton问题 2022-01-01
- Android - 我如何找出用户有多少未读电子邮件? 2022-01-01
- 在测试浓缩咖啡时,Android设备不会在屏幕上启动活动 2022-01-01
- Android viewpager检测滑动超出范围 2022-01-01
- 使用自定义动画时在 iOS9 上忽略 edgesForExtendedLayout 2022-01-01
- 想使用ViewPager,无法识别android.support.*? 2022-01-01
- Android - 拆分 Drawable 2022-01-01